About
Dr Anthony Stanislaus, MBBS, PBM is Hisential's founder and resident physician. His background spans radiology residency, hospital attachments in orthopaedics, internal medicine, and surgery, chief-resident work in a large men's-health network, provider-network leadership at MHC Asia Group, and COO work during the formation of Innoquest Diagnostics. He holds a Graduate Diploma in Family Medicine from NUS, an Executive MBA from NUS Business School, a Society of Men's Health Singapore certificate, and peer-reviewed oncology and drug-delivery publications.

Signature approach
Stanislaus brings a diagnostic lens to men's health. Screening results, hormone panels, metabolic markers, imaging context, and STI/HIV workups are read as early signals for what needs attention next. That fits Hisential's model: use testing to clarify risk and mechanism, then move into testosterone, ED, sexual-health, chronic-disease, weight, or prevention care with a single physician relationship.
